Over the past 30 years, there have been 24 property sales recorded in the HA5 3HE postcode area. The highest sale price reached £1,350,000, while the most recent sale was for a detached bungalow sold in April 2024 for £1,175,000.
The estimated average property value in HA5 3HE currently stands at £1,154,733, which is approximately 57.1% higher than the city average, indicating a potentially more desirable or in-demand location.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£8,662.
Property prices in HA5 3HE have risen by 2.1% over the past year , with a total increase of 17.4%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 36.2%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is semi-detached, making up around 46% of transactions , followed by detached and flat.
Housing in HA5 3HE is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 91% of homes being lived in by the owners.
